The electrophysiological assessment of visual function in Multiple Sclerosis
Joshua L Barton1, Justin Y Garber1, Alexander Klistorner2,3
1Brain & Mind Centre, University of Sydney, NSW, Australia.
Visual evoked potentials are crucial for diagnosing and monitoring multiple sclerosis (MS) patients. New techniques and therapies are renewing interest in this vision assessment method for MS management.

Background:
- Vision assessment is key in diagnosing and monitoring multiple sclerosis (MS).
- Visual electrophysiology, including visual evoked potentials (VEPs), was historically vital for MS diagnosis.
- Magnetic resonance imaging (MRI) has largely replaced VEPs in routine clinical practice for MS.
Purpose of the Study:
- To review the clinical applications of VEPs in managing MS patients.
- To discuss the technical considerations and limitations of using VEPs in MS.
- To highlight the resurgence of interest in VEPs due to advancements in technology and therapies.
Main Methods:
- Review of clinical applications of visual evoked potentials (VEPs).
- Discussion of technical aspects and limitations of VEPs.
- Focus on multi-focal VEPs and their role in monitoring re-myelinating therapies.
Main Results:
- VEPs remain valuable for specific aspects of MS assessment.
- Advancements like multi-focal VEPs offer new monitoring capabilities.
- VEPs are relevant for evaluating the efficacy of emerging re-myelinating treatments.
Conclusions:
- Visual evoked potentials are regaining importance in MS management.
- Technical considerations and limitations must be addressed for optimal VEP use.
- VEPs provide a complementary tool to MRI in the comprehensive care of MS patients.
